Transaction 958990f4ded85c4fa214bec61e5c54074b1ab4f6947995a3a9f4397726514f73

1 Input
2 Outputs
  • 958990f4ded85c4fa214bec61e5c54074b1ab4f6947995a3a9f4397726514f73:0
  • value  26844010
    address  1KqaUhsbhMV9f8QA5m89sRGoXBfJAkWMP
  • 958990f4ded85c4fa214bec61e5c54074b1ab4f6947995a3a9f4397726514f73:1
  • value  11044592
    address  1NQsrAgG3XEE9XNwCy2RCjKQJJrFv7Ka2D